Live dealer games operate using advanced streaming technology that broadcasts a real casino setup to players online. Professional dealers manage the games in real time, just as they would in a physical casino. Players can interact with the dealer and other participants through chat features, creating a truly immersive experience. Popular games include bl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ker, with many platforms even offering unique variations to keep things exciting.
One of the main reasons live dealer games have become so popular is trust. Unlike purely digital games, where outcomes are determined by random number generators (RNGs), live dealer games provide visible, human-controlled results. This transparency builds confidence, especially among players who prefer tangible proof of fairness.

Of course, live dealer games aren’t without their challenges. They require strong internet connectivity, and the experience can be affected by lag or streaming issues on slower devices. Moreover, since the games are live, they operate on a schedule and are not as instantly accessible as automated games.
